Dolores Montoya Rodríguez, better known as Lole Montoya, was born into a Gitano family in the Triana neighbourhood. Her parents are dancers Juan Montoya and singer and dancer Antonia Rodríguez "La Negra".

Lole Montoya began her musical career as one half of the duo Lole y Manuel with her partner Manuel Molina Jiménez. Together they performed for over two decades, and released records such as Romero Verde and Nuevo Día. In 1989, she embarked on her solo career, and today she continues to perform at major theatres.
